private DataTable getProcessedOrderforms() { DataTable dt = new DataTable(); dataGridView1.DataSource = T_OrderFormHeadDL.SelectAllt_OrderFormHeadApproval(); return(dt); }
private void LoadData() { if (dataGridView1.SelectedRows.Count > 0) { codex = dataGridView1.SelectedRows[0].Cells[0].Value.ToString(); cat = new T_OrderFormHead(); cat.DocNo = codex.Trim(); T_OrderFormHeadDL dl = new T_OrderFormHeadDL(); cat = dl.Selectt_OrderFormHead(cat); txt_DocNo.Text = cat.DocNo; txt_Locacode.Text = cat.Locacode.Trim(); txt_locationId_name.Text = findExisting.FindExisitingLoca(txt_Locacode.Text); txt_Customer.Text = cat.Customer.Trim(); txt_Customer_name.Text = findExisting.FindExisitingCUstomer(txt_Customer.Text); txt_Remarks.Text = cat.Remarks; //dte_date.Value = cat.Datex.Value; //dte_RecivedDate.Value = cat.RecivedDate.Value; txt_NetTotal.Text = cat.NetTotal.ToString(); txt_Subtotal.Text = cat.Subtotal.ToString(); txt_subtotdiscper.Text = cat.DiscountPer.ToString(); txt_TotalDisc.Text = cat.TotalDisc.ToString(); txt_subtotdisc.Text = cat.SubtotalDisc.ToString(); M_Customers cusx = new M_Customers(); cusx.CusID = cat.Customer.Trim(); cusx = new M_CustomerDL().Selectm_Customer(cusx); txt_os.Text = cusx.customerOS.ToString(); txt_creditlimit.Text = cusx.CreditLimit.ToString(); lbl_creditPeriod.Text = cusx.CreditPeriod.ToString(); dataGridView2.DataSource = T_OrderFormHeadDL.GetCreditNoteItems(cat.Customer.Trim()); dataGridView2.Columns[0].Width = 120; dataGridView2.Columns[1].Width = 120; dataGridView2.Columns[2].Width = 120; dataGridView2.Columns[3].Width = 120; dataGridView2.Refresh(); dataGridView3.DataSource = T_OrderFormHeadDL.GetInvoiceDetails(cat.Customer.Trim()); dataGridView3.Columns[0].Width = 120; dataGridView3.Columns[1].Width = 120; dataGridView3.Columns[2].Width = 120; dataGridView3.Columns[3].Width = 120; dataGridView3.Refresh(); } }
private void btn_edit_Click(object sender, EventArgs e) { if (codex.Trim() != "") { if (UserDefineMessages.ShowMsg("", UserDefineMessages.Msg_PerfmBtn_Approve, commonFunctions.Softwarename.Trim()) == System.Windows.Forms.DialogResult.Yes) { T_OrderFormHead objt_trnsferNote = new T_OrderFormHead(); objt_trnsferNote.DocNo = txt_DocNo.Text.Trim(); objt_trnsferNote = new T_OrderFormHeadDL().Selectt_OrderFormHead(objt_trnsferNote); objt_trnsferNote.DiscountPer = commonFunctions.ToDecimal(txt_subtotdiscper.Text.Trim()); objt_trnsferNote.TotalDisc = commonFunctions.ToDecimal(txt_TotalDisc.Text.Trim()); objt_trnsferNote.NetTotal = commonFunctions.ToDecimal(txt_NetTotal.Text.Trim()); objt_trnsferNote.Approved = 1; objt_trnsferNote.ApprovedDate = DateTime.Now; objt_trnsferNote.ApprovedBy = commonFunctions.Loginuser; objt_trnsferNote.Remarks = txt_Remarks.Text.Trim(); new T_OrderFormHeadDL().Savet_OrderFormHeadSP(objt_trnsferNote, 3); T_OrderTracking track = new T_OrderTracking(); track.OFNo = objt_trnsferNote.DocNo.Trim(); track = new T_OrderTrackingDL().Selectt_OrderTracking(track, xEnums.OrderTrackingTypes.OrderNo); track.OFApproved = 1; track.OFApprovedUser = commonFunctions.Loginuser; track.OFApprovedDate = DateTime.Now; new T_OrderTrackingDL().Savet_OrderTrackingSP(track, 3); getProcessedOrderforms(); UserDefineMessages.ShowMsg("", UserDefineMessages.Msg_Update_Sucess, commonFunctions.Softwarename.Trim()); } } else { errorProvider1.SetError(dataGridView1, "Pelase select a order form from the list"); commonFunctions.SetMDIStatusMessage("Pelase select a order form from the list", 1); } }